  • Jonagold sports a unique honey-tart flavor, and crispy, juicy nearly yellow flesh and a yellow-green base skin color with a red-orange blush.
  • Excellent for eating fresh and for cooking, Jonagold apples are great for fried apples. Sauté them in butter, add a little cinnamon, and serve!
  • Jonagold apples originated at the New York State Agricultural Experiment Station. A blend of Jonathan and Golden Delicious apples they debuted in 1968.
  • The naming came as a combination of its parents Jonathan and Golden Delicious.

Expanded Information about Jonagold Apples from Honeycrisp.com

Origin and History: Jonagold apples, renowned for their balanced sweet-tart flavor and firm texture, originated in the United States in the 20th century. They are a hybrid variety, resulting from a cross between the Jonathan and Golden Delicious apple varieties, developed by Cornell University's apple breeding program in the 1940s. Jonagold apples were officially introduced to the market in the 1960s, quickly gaining popularity among consumers and orchardists for their exceptional taste and versatility in culinary use.

Growing Conditions: Jonagold apple trees thrive in regions with temperate climates, particularly in areas with well-drained soil and ample sunlight. They require adequate moisture and good airflow to prevent diseases and ensure healthy fruit development. Jonagold trees may benefit from regular pruning and thinning to maintain tree structure and promote fruit quality. Proper care and management are essential to maximize fruit production and minimize pest and disease pressures.

Tree Characteristics: Jonagold apple trees are known for their vigorous growth habit and relatively large size compared to other apple tree varieties. They typically reach heights of 15 to 20 feet at maturity and have a spreading growth habit. Pruning is essential to manage tree size, shape, and fruit production, with attention to thinning out branches and promoting airflow within the canopy. Jonagold trees may begin bearing fruit at a young age, usually within three to four years after planting.

Physical Appearance: Jonagold apples are large-sized fruits with a round to slightly oblong shape. They have a distinctive yellow-green background covered with a red blush and occasional striping, giving them a visually striking appearance. Jonagold apples often exhibit a smooth, glossy skin that is thin and delicate. Their flesh is creamy-yellow, firm, and juicy, with a fine texture that holds up well in storage and transportation.

Flavor and Aroma Profile: Jonagold apples are prized for their well-balanced sweet-tart flavor with hints of honey and citrus. They offer a firm, crisp texture and a refreshing taste that makes them enjoyable for fresh eating and snacking. The aroma is mildly aromatic, with subtle floral and fruity notes that enhance the overall sensory experience. Jonagold apples are often described as having a "juicy-crisp" texture, making them a favorite among apple enthusiasts.

Harvesting and Storage: Harvesting of Jonagold apples typically occurs in the fall, usually from late September to early October, depending on the specific growing region and climate. It's essential to pick Jonagold apples at the peak of ripeness to ensure optimal flavor, texture, and sweetness. Proper storage is crucial to maintain their quality and extend their shelf life. Jonagold apples should be stored in cool, humid conditions, such as refrigeration or controlled atmosphere storage, to preserve their crispness and flavor. With proper handling and storage, Jonagold apples can be kept fresh for several months, allowing consumers to enjoy them throughout the harvest season and beyond.

Versatility in Culinary Use: Jonagold apples are highly versatile and excel in various culinary applications, including fresh eating, salads, baking, and desserts. They are favored for making pies, crisps, and cobblers, as well as for use in salads and fruit platters due to their exceptional flavor and texture. Their ability to hold their shape when cooked makes them ideal for baking and cooking applications. Jonagold apples are also popular for making applesauce, apple cider, and juice, as their naturally sweet-tart flavor adds depth and complexity to these preparations.

Nutritional Value: Jonagold apples offer nutritional benefits, including vitamins, minerals, dietary fiber, and antioxidants. They are a good source of vitamin C, potassium, and dietary fiber, contributing to overall health and well-being. Jonagold apples are low in calories and fat, making them a nutritious snack option for those watching their weight or following a healthy diet. Incorporating Jonagold apples into a balanced diet can help support immune function, promote digestive health, and reduce the risk of chronic diseases such as heart disease and cancer.

Q&A - QUESTIONS AND ANSWERS ABOUT Jonagold APPLES

From The Apple Crunchers of Honeycrisp.com

What distinguishes Jonagold apples from other varieties?

    • Jonagold apples, a cross between the tart Jonathan and the sweet Golden Delicious, are known for their large size, vibrant color, and a perfect balance of sweet and tart flavors.

How do Jonagold apples taste?

    • They offer a rich, honeyed sweetness with just the right amount of acidity, making them incredibly flavorful and juicy.

When are Jonagold apples in season?

    • Typically harvested in the fall, Jonagold apples are best from late September through February, thanks to their good storage life.

Are Jonagold apples good for baking?

    • Absolutely, their balance of sweetness and acidity makes them excellent for baking, retaining their texture and flavor well.

Can Jonagold apples be eaten raw?

    • Yes, their juicy and crisp nature makes them delightful for fresh eating.

What makes Jonagold apples popular for snacking?

    • The combination of their sweet-tart flavor, juicy bite, and crunchy texture appeals to a wide audience, making them a favorite snack choice.

How should Jonagold apples be stored?

    • Keep them in the refrigerator to preserve their crispness and extend their shelf life.

Where did Jonagold apples originate?

    • Jonagold apples were first developed in Geneva, New York, at the New York State Agricultural Experiment Station in the 1950s.

Can Jonagold apples be used for making applesauce?

    • Their natural sweetness and slight acidity produce a flavorful applesauce, often eliminating the need for added sugar.

Do Jonagold apples have health benefits?

    • They are a good source of dietary fiber and vitamin C, supporting digestive health and the immune system.

Why are Jonagold apples favored in children's lunches?

    • Their sweet flavor and satisfying crunch make them appealing to kids, plus they're less prone to browning.

Can Jonagold apples be frozen?

    • While best enjoyed fresh, Jonagold apples can be frozen, particularly when prepped for pies or sauces.

How do Jonagold apples compare to Fuji apples?

    • Jonagold apples have a more balanced sweet-tart flavor compared to the predominantly sweet Fuji apples, with a slightly softer texture when ripe.

What's the best use for Jonagold apples in the kitchen?

    • Jonagold apples excel in both sweet and savory dishes, from pies and crisps to salads and sauces, thanks to their versatile flavor profile.

Can Jonagold apples be used in salads?

    • Yes, their crisp texture and balanced flavor make them an excellent addition to any salad.

How do you know when Jonagold apples are ripe?

    • Ripe Jonagold apples have a beautiful blend of red and yellow coloring, are firm to the touch, and emit a fragrant aroma.

Are Jonagold apples good for juicing?

    • Yes, they produce a sweet and slightly tangy juice, perfect for drinking fresh or using in recipes.

Can I grow Jonagold apples in my garden?

    • With the right climate (zones 4-8) and proper care, Jonagold apples can thrive in home gardens.

What are the challenges of growing Jonagold apples?

    • They can be susceptible to certain pests and diseases, requiring careful monitoring and management for a healthy crop.

How long does it take for a Jonagold apple tree to bear fruit?

    • Typically, Jonagold apple trees start bearing fruit within 4 to 5 years after planting.

Are there any special tips for cooking with Jonagold apples?

    • Their sweet-tart flavor enhances many dishes; consider using them in recipes that call for a balance of sweetness and acidity.

Can Jonagold apples be used for cider?

    • They are an excellent choice for cider, adding depth and a complex flavor profile to the blend.

What makes Jonagold apples a supermarket favorite?

    • Their appealing flavor, versatility, and attractive appearance make them a sought-after choice for consumers.

How can you select the best Jonagold apples at the store?

    • Opt for apples that are firm, vibrant in color, and free from bruises or punctures.

Can Jonagold apples be part of a healthy diet?

    • Definitely, their fiber content and vitamins contribute to a balanced and nutritious diet.

Are there different types of Jonagold apples?

    • While Jonagold is itself a specific hybrid, there are various strains that may exhibit slight differences in color and size.

How do Jonagold apples impact the flavor of apple pies?

    • They add a delicious sweet-tart flavor and maintain a pleasing texture in pies, making them a popular choice for baking.

What's the history behind Jonagold apples?

    • Bred to combine the best traits of Jonathan and Golden Delicious, Jonagold apples have gained fame for their exceptional taste and versatility.

Are Jonagold apples suitable for diabetic diets?

    • When consumed in moderation, their natural sugars and fiber can be part of a balanced approach to managing diabetes.

How does the texture of Jonagold apples influence their use in recipes?

    • Their firm yet tender texture is ideal for both raw and cooked applications, offering culinary flexibility.

Can Jonagold apples be grilled?

    • Grilling enhances their natural sweetness, making them a fantastic addition to both sweet and savory dishes.

What are some creative ways to use Jonagold apples?

    • Experiment with them in smoothies, chutneys, or even as an addition to grilled cheese sandwiches for a sweet twist.

How do Jonagold apples fare in cold storage?

    • They store exceptionally well, retaining their texture and flavor for several months when refrigerated correctly.

Can Jonagold apples be shipped without losing quality?

    • Their robust nature allows for shipping with minimal quality loss, ensuring they reach consumers in excellent condition.

What makes Jonagold apples so popular among apple varieties?

    • Their unique flavor, adaptability in cooking, and satisfying crunch have made them a beloved choice among apple connoisseurs.

How should Jonagold apples be prepared for kids?

    • Cutting them into slices or chunks makes them an accessible and enjoyable snack for children.
